Comprehensive Overview of Advanced Structural Analysis by Ashok K. Jain
Advanced Structural Analysis by Dr. Ashok K. Jain is a definitive resource for civil and structural engineering students and professionals seeking to master complex indeterminate structures. This textbook, often associated with its Third (2015) and Fourth (2023) editions, provides a rigorous transition from basic elementary analysis to high-level computational methods like the Finite Element Method (FEM) and matrix stiffness approach. Core Themes and Subject Matter
The book is structured to guide readers through the evolution of structural analysis, from classical hand-calculated methods to modern computer-aided techniques.
Matrix Methods: A major focus is placed on the Flexibility and Stiffness Matrix Methods. These methods are essential for analyzing complex frames, trusses, and beams that are statically indeterminate.
Finite Element Method (FEM): Recent editions integrate FEM to prepare students for using professional engineering software with a deep understanding of the underlying numerical algorithms.
Statically Indeterminate Structures: The text covers advanced topics such as the method of consistent deformation, strain energy, and slope-deflection methods.
Plastic and Nonlinear Analysis: Dr. Jain explores material and geometric nonlinearity, as well as plastic analysis of beams and frames. Practical Features for Students Advanced Structural Analysis By Ashok K Jain Pdf 320
The textbook is highly regarded for its pedagogical approach, making it a staple for competitive exams like GATE and UPSC (ESE).
Solved Examples: The third edition includes over 170 solved examples, while the fourth edition boasts more than 200 illustrative problems to clarify theoretical concepts.
Practice Problems: To test comprehension, the book provides roughly 350 practice problems with answers provided for many.
